What does an aerodynamics engineer do?
To achieve flight, heavier-than-air objects like planes or rockets must conform to certain principles of aerodynamics. Aerodynamics is the study of the motion of air and its interaction with solid objects. An aerodynamics engineer tests aerospace designs, such as aircraft bodies and propulsion systems to ensure they meet all aerodynamic specifications and conform to the physical laws of aerodynamics. Your duties and responsibilities include designing mathematical models and simulations to test designs before firms construct prototypes or full products. You also work to improve the efficiency of existing designs.

What is the difference between Aerodynamics Engineer vs Aerospace Engineer?
| Aspect | Aerodynamics Engineer | Aerospace Engineer |
|---|---|---|
| Required Credentials | Bachelor's or Master's in Aerospace, Mechanical, or Aeronautical Engineering | Bachelor's or Master's in Aerospace, Mechanical, or related engineering fields |
| Work Environment | Design labs, wind tunnels, simulation software, aircraft or vehicle testing sites | Design, development, testing of aircraft, spacecraft, and related systems |
| Industry Usage | Primarily in aeronautics, automotive, and defense sectors focusing on airflow and performance | Broader aerospace sector including aircraft, spacecraft, satellites, and defense systems |
While both roles require similar educational backgrounds and often work in related environments, Aerodynamics Engineers focus specifically on airflow and performance optimization, whereas Aerospace Engineers have a broader scope including design and development of entire aerospace systems.

About the Department
The Department of Mechanical and Aerospace Engineering (MAE) at North Carolina State University (Raleigh, NC) is the largest in the state and among the largest and most prominent in the nation. The department offers Bachelor of Science (BS), Master of Science (MS) and Doctor of Philosophy(PhD) degrees in both Mechanical Engineering (ME) and Aerospace Engineering (AE). The department also offers an accelerated BS/MS degrees in both mechanical engineering and aerospace engineering.
The strengths of the department include the thermal sciences, particularly thermal fluids, fluid mechanics, and combustion; mechanical sciences, including manufacturing mechanics, structural dynamics, materials, and controls; and the aerospace sciences, particularly aerodynamics, aircraft design, hypersonics, propulsion, flight research using UAVs, and computational fluid dynamics.
The Department of Mechanical and Aerospace Engineering has an enrollment of approximately 1000 undergraduate students, 400 graduate students, and highly recognized faculty. About North Carolina State University
Sourced by ZipRecruiter
North Carolina State University (NCSU), located in Raleigh, NC, US, is a leading educational institution with a strong emphasis on research, academics, and public service. Established in 1887, NCSU operates in the education industry and endeavors to foster student success, and promote economic development by providing high-quality, affordable education, and conducting groundbreaking research across a variety of disciplines. With more than 100 majors, its academic offerings range from undergraduates to postgraduates along with doctoral studies - in various fields like engineering, natural resources, humanities, and social sciences. NCSU is firmly anchored on the core values of respect, responsibility, integrity, and innovation. Its mission is to create economic, societal, and intellectual prosperity for the people of North Carolina and the nation.
